Airway Clearance with Expiratory Flow Accelerator Technology: Effectiveness of the "Free Aspire" Device in Patients with Severe COPD.

Giorgia Patrizio1, Michele D'Andria2, Francesco D'Abrosca3, Antonella Cabiaglia1, Fabio Tanzi4, Giancarlo Garuti5, Antonello Nicolini6.   

Abstract

OBJECTIVES: Chronic obstructive pulmonary disease (COPD) is associated with a higher risk of pulmonary infections. This risk not only negatively affects patients' quality of life but also increases social and health costs. Hence, there is a need for an effective rehabilitative treatment including airway clearance. The aim of this pilot study was to evaluate the efficacy of a new tool for bronchial clearance based on expiratory flow accelerator (EFA) technology compared with positive expiratory pressure (PEP) treatment.
MATERIALS AND METHODS: Twenty stable patients with COPD, Global Initiative for Chronic Obstructive Lung Disease 3-4 stage, were enrolled and allocated to treatment with EFA or Bubble-PEP (BP) for 20 days during a pulmonary rehabilitation program. At baseline and the end of treatment, the following parameters were measured: arterial blood gases (ABG); respiratory function, including peak cough expiratory flow (PCEF), maximal inspiratory pressure (MIP), and maximal expiratory pressure exercise capacity using the 6-minute walk test (6MWT), dyspnea using the Medical Research Council scale, and quality of life using the St. George's Respiratory Questionnaire.
RESULTS: Expiratory flow accelerator showed a significant pre- and post-improvement in ABG and a significantly greater improvement than BP in PCEF, MIP, and 6MWT post-treatment.
CONCLUSION: Expiratory flow accelerator is a valid device compared with BP as an adjunctive therapy for the treatment of patients with severe COPD.
